Thursday, July 15th, 2010. Issue 28, Volume 14. FALLBROOK – There will be three seats open in the November election on the board of directors for the Fallbrook Healthcare District. The term of office for a director is four years. Following the election, the term of office for the three individuals would be December 2010 through November 2014. The district is committed to continuing services provided by Fallbrook Hospital; identifying, promoting and supporting a broad range of healthcare related needs within the district and managing healthcare district assets. Revenue of the Fallbrook Healthcare District (FHD) comes solely through property tax apportionment. This year’s (2009-2010) revenue from apportionment is approximately $1.5 million. A person seeking to serve on this board must be a registered voter and must live within Advertisement The seats currently held by Gordon Tinker, Milt Davies, and Hollis Moyse will be open for election. The district says Tinker and Davies plan on running for reelection, while Moyse does not. The other two seats on the board are held by Barbara Mroz and Lynette Shumway, whose terms run through November 2012.
